I haven't really thought about this in years, but while under the car recently chasing oil leaks I thought it best to finally throw this out to the community.
We all know what cracked frame epoxy looks like. We all know what rust under said epoxy looks like, but my frame has some weird epoxy happenings in the back right corner of the car.
It looks to me like the epoxy never adhered properly right from the get-go. The other thought was that it was damaged by heat or fire. It seems to be thin, bubbly and/or flakey while also changing colour and texture.
It exists along the RH rear of the engine cradle then back along the top and bottom of the frame extension around the inner pontoon to the right of the alternator.
Has anyone ever seen this? It's rock solid and there is no evidence of any rust.
